Output 590922ec35aee281f2b7ddca226ccb680dbc60d792b884abfdfa6d24b0dd0141:75

value
14632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b622a3d523a88ccdee414ed648b9193e2da1820 OP_EQUALVERIFY OP_CHECKSIG
address
1NTbPhpa6HbJ21ZdNLNgMMyyn2qekEJYsJ
transaction
590922ec35aee281f2b7ddca226ccb680dbc60d792b884abfdfa6d24b0dd0141
spent
true